1. Understanding Personalized Learning Systems
1.1 Definition and Purpose
Personalized learning systems use technology to tailor educational content, pace, and feedback to each learner’s needs. These systems leverage:
Student performance data
Behavioral insights
Learning styles
Engagement levels
The result is a highly individualized learning journey that maximizes effectiveness and minimizes frustration.
1.2 Role of AI in Personalization
Traditional education often applies a one-size-fits-all approach. In contrast, AI brings personalization through:
Predictive analytics: Forecasts how students will perform based on past data.
Natural Language Processing (NLP): Understands student queries and provides contextual answers.
Reinforcement learning: Adjusts content delivery based on student interaction and outcomes.
Recommendation engines: Suggests activities, lessons, or content suited to a learner’s current level.

3. AI Agent Development in Education
3.1 What Are Learning Agents?
AI agent development in education involves creating autonomous systems that guide, tutor, and assess learners dynamically. These agents can:
Simulate human tutors
Deliver contextual hints during lessons
Monitor learning progress
Trigger interventions when students are struggling
Examples include virtual teaching assistants, AI mentors, and automated essay graders.
3.2 How Learning Agents Work
AI agents use multi-modal data—text inputs, clickstreams, quiz scores—to make real-time decisions. For example, if a student repeatedly fails a concept, the agent might:
Pause the current topic
Provide a simpler explanation
Recommend a different learning modality (video, simulation, etc.)

5. Real-World Use Cases
5.1 K-12 Education
Schools are using AI to support differentiated instruction. Platforms like DreamBox and Squirrel AI personalize math and reading exercises based on each student’s mastery level.
5.2 Higher Education
Universities deploy AI to:
Match students with optimal courses
Provide career guidance through intelligent recommendation engines
Detect academic dishonesty using AI proctoring tools
5.3 Corporate Training
Businesses use AI to upskill employees through:
Microlearning platforms with personalized modules
Skill gap analysis via AI-powered assessments
AI mentors that recommend learning paths based on job roles
5.4 Special Education
AI agents can assist learners with disabilities by:
Translating text to speech
Offering emotion-aware feedback
Customizing lesson pacing based on neurodivergence

7. Challenges and Ethical Considerations
7.1 Data Privacy and Consent
Personalized learning systems handle sensitive student data. Compliance with laws like FERPA and GDPR is essential.
7.2 Bias in AI Models
If training data is biased, AI may reinforce educational inequality. Regular audits and inclusive data practices are critical.
7.3 Over-Reliance on Automation
While AI enhances learning, it should not replace human connection. A balanced approach combining human teachers with intelligent systems is best.
